Output 858c02c85c9c62e5297295567d9aa3a24f4b5318f7104665ac0726b8f99c4f4e:2

value
207577329
script pubkey
OP_0 OP_PUSHBYTES_20 23311bacb76b1aa29113eabdb2cf215d16dcbba1
address
bc1qyvc3ht9hdvd29ygna27m9nept5tdewapgzww86
transaction
858c02c85c9c62e5297295567d9aa3a24f4b5318f7104665ac0726b8f99c4f4e
confirmations
363685
spent
true